BMS (Battery Management System) :
Embeds core intelligence of PowerRack system
BMS embeds some smart balancing algorithm that controls that all cells in the system are constantly at the same voltage level. State of Charge (SoC) and State of Health (SoH) are precisely measured by powerful algorithms.
BMS is also equipped with a built-in multi-protocol communication module (CAN, CAN open, RS232, ModBus) to back up all operating information for external monitoring, or for integration with other systems.
Modularity and scalability of PowerRack system offer a wide range of configurations :
- PowerRack supports from one single module, up to 500 modules.
- Stored energy can vary from 2.5kWh to 1280 kWh.
- Nominal voltage range from 51.2V to 1024V.
